Kingston KC3000 512GB NVMe drive

The Kingston KC3000 is a 512GB internal SSD built for consumer PCs that need fast storage in a compact M.2 2280 form factor. It uses a Phison E18 controller with 3D TLC memory and a PCIe 4.0 x4 NVMe interface. A low-profile graphene aluminum heat spreader is included to manage thermals.

Sustained load behaviour

Under continuous operation the drive draws up to 2.7W during read activity and up to 4.1W during write activity, while idle power is just 5 mW. The controller and heat spreader are designed to maintain performance within the 0°C to 70°C operating range. Endurance is rated at 400TB written and MTBF is 1,800,000 hours.

PCIe 4.0 x4 interface limits

The PCIe 4.0 x4 NVMe link caps maximum sequential throughput at 7000 MBps read and 3900 MBps write. Random 4KB performance reaches 450,000 IOPS read and 900,000 IOPS write. The drive also tolerates 2.17G peak vibration while operating and 20G peak when powered off.

Questions about this item

Will this M.2 2280 drive fit in a laptop slot that only has room for a single-sided module?

The drive measures 2.21 mm in height and includes a low-profile graphene aluminium heat spreader, so it fits most single-sided M.2 slots.

My motherboard has a PCIe 4.0 x4 M.2 socket — will I see the advertised 7000 MB/s read speed?

Yes, the Phison E18 controller and PCIe 4.0 x4 NVMe interface deliver up to 7000 MB/s sequential read when the platform supports PCIe 4.0.

Is the 400 TBW endurance rating enough for a workstation that writes 50 GB per day?

At 50 GB daily, 400 TBW provides over 20 years of write endurance, well beyond typical workstation lifespans.
